Singanallur Assembly Election Result 1996

Tamil Nadu · Vidhan Sabha (State Assembly) Election 1996

Palaniswamy, N. of Dravida Munetra Kazhagam won the Singanallur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ency in Tamil Nadu in the 1996 state assembly election, securing 92,379 votes (60.20% vote share). The runner-up was Duraisamy, R. (All India Anna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am) with 33,967 votes.

A total of 38 candidates contested this assembly seat. State Assembly elections elect Members of the Legislative Assembly (MLAs) using India's First-Past-The-Post (FPTP) system, and the party or alliance winning a majority of seats forms the state government. Position Candidate Name Votes Votes% Party
1 Palaniswamy, N. 92379 60.20% Dravida Munetra Kazhagam
2 Duraisamy, R. 33967 22.10% All India Anna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am
3 Kannappan, M. 19951 13.00% Marumalarchi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am
4 Kalyanasundaram, R. 3741 2.40% Bharatiya Janata Party
